Numerous applications have been developed to take advantage of the high fidelity of Taq and other thermostable DNA ligases. Thermostable DNA ligases are active at elevated temperatures, allowing further discrimination by incubating the ligation at a temperature near the melting temperature (Tm) of the DNA strands. Ligases from thermophilic bacteria exhibit much higher fidelity of even one up to two orders of magnitude more than bacteriophage T4 DNA Ligase. PubMed Central PMCID: PMC4737175. 25. T4 DNA ligase is highly active in nick ligation and DNA end-joining, but will also efficiently ligate many undesirable structures, including substrates containing gaps or DNA base pair mismatches (8-11). DNA ligases generally prefer fully Watson-Crick base-paired dsDNA substrates to those containing one or more mismatches. 7. ", Pascal, John M., et al. PCR Methods Appl 3.4 (1994): S51-64. "DNA ligases ensure fidelity by interrogating minor groove contacts. PubMed PMID: 16511246. However, some ligases can ligate mismatches to a significant degree, and very active ligases, such as T4 DNA Ligase, can ligate nicks containing one or more mismatches near the ligation junction with high efficiency (11, 21). DNA ligases have been generally found to have a higher discrimination at the upstream side of the ligation junction (the base pair providing the 3 ́-OH terminus to the ligation) than on the downstream side (the base pair providing the 5 ́-phosphate to the ligation). In vitro, ligases (notably T4 DNA ligase) are critical reagents for many molecular biology protocols, including vector-insert joining for recombinant plasmid construction (restriction cloning), adaptor ligation for next generation sequencing (NGS) library construction, and circularization of dsDNA (6).
